Default Shaky Dog Racing competing in One Lap of America



So here we go, Shaky Dog Racing team members are in-route to South Bend, IN for the 33rd running of Brock Yates One Lap of America.



This year we will be fielding a team of 3 corvettes competing against some of the fastest street cars in the country.

Christopher and Tina Lewis will be driving a 2015 Z06/Z07.



Cletus and Brenda Kraft will also be driving a 2015 Z06/Z07



Chris and Jen Brierly will be driving a 2007 C6 Z06



We will be starting in South Bend at the Tire Rack facility on Saturday with a wet skipped. From there we head to Pittrace, Palmer, Summit Point, NCM, Road America, Autobahn and finally return to South Bend.

Well, day one is in the books and Shaky Dog Racing is all over the scoreboard. Chris and Jen Brierly in the 2.0 Minions car pulled out a 7th overall finish while the other two cars didn't fare quite as well. Props to Chris for going the extra mile and adjusting his swaybars in the rain.

Shaky dog was the first to arrive at the transit passage control at Lake Erie Harley Davidson by five minutes and the first to the hotel tonight. At least we're first at something today. It was a sopping wet and rainy drive for 380 miles today.

Wet day at Pitt today. Shaky Dog cars finished 7th, 21st and 29th this morning on a very wet track. Catesby Jones, defending champ, went off on his first lap and contacted the guardrail ending his one lap. The forge ahead Viper of Steve Loudin and Tom Drewer had a electrical issue and missed the second session.

Currently, Shaky dog cars are in 9th, 12th and 47th overall after the morning session.
